CVE-2026-33686 is a high-severity path traversal vulnerability affecting Sharp, a content management framework for Laravel, in versions prior to 9.20.0. The flaw resides in the FileUtil class, where improper sanitization of file extensions allows path separators to be passed to the storage layer. Rated with a CVSS score of 8.8 (High), this vulnerability can be exploited remotely with low privileges and no user interaction, potentially leading to high imp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ability. While there is no evidence of active exploitation, nor publicly available exploit code in Metasploit, Nuclei, or ExploitDB, the vulnerability has garnered some community discussion, indicating awareness among security researchers. Organizations using affected versions should upgrade to 9.20.0 or later to mitigate this risk.
